Hope you are feeling OK. Going to make a few short sharp points.
Do NOT worry about complications, they will just make you sad. They are a long time off. I am a near 30 year diabetic T1, so now is my time to worry about them - hence my gym bunny lifestyle.
DO test your bloods as often as you can. I do mine 4-5 a day. The Insulinx machine is perfect for you. I love mine. Some are high, some are perfect, some are low. That's just diabetes messing with ya.
Carb count but do NOT give up your favourite junk foods - I love a KFC every now and again. Try and get onto a DAFNE course if you can, it will make a huge difference to how you see diabetes and food.
Get into the fresh air and walk. Nothing clears your head like a good walk. Drive out somewhere nice to walk if you have to.
But above all, accept some days will be good. Some will be bad. You can strive for perfect control but you will never achieve it. Everything else will fall into place.
